Fox News analyst and former Superior Court judge Andrew Napolitano said the president must meet his challenges 'soberly, directly and maturely.'
President Donald Trump could yet survive the multitude of attacks and investigations against him, but not if he keeps having weeks as bad as the one just passed, a Fox News analyst and former superior court judge warned.
Trump’s summit with North Korean leader Kim Jong Un in Hanoi, Vietnam, proved to be a bust. For all the president’s bluster and bragging on North Korea, very little of substance has been achieved since he took office. Last week’s summit ended early after what Napolitano described as “pseudo-negotiations” yielded no agreement on denuclearization and sanctions relief.
In Congress, Trump faces a new wide-reaching investigation launched by the House Judiciary Committee, which has already issued document requests to 81 agencies, individuals and entities connected to the president. Trump has already dismissed the requests, calling the investigation"a disgrace to our country."
